Gunnar looked up into the night sky, it was dark. Beside him stood Leslie, holding a medium-to-large painting, ready to execute the heist of the century. They had a yellow car, a fast car, and a helicopter pilot named Cass who was standing on a roof... WAIT! Do NOT buy this book! This is not a thriller/action-romance. It is a disaster. My author is attempting to write a prequel to a bestseller that hasn't even been thought of yet. I am a backstory to a future that does not exist. If you open these pages, you will be subjected to the most agonizing, copy-pasted plot in literary history. There are corpses that are dead. People crying with actual tears. And a helicopter pilot who spends most of their time doing things for no logical reason. I am begging you: don't read this book. The author wants us to go forward, but I am pulling us back. If you insist on reading, prepare yourself for The Vector Paradox.
Seriously. Save yourself and me. Buy any other book instead.
This is the third book that Decirée has published and has also taken on a new genre, meta-fiction, she describes it as "A piece of meta-humor that breaks the fourth wall."
